Retrieve grievances and recent gossip for each met civilization to predict AI hostility and inform decisions on war, peace, or World Congress votes.

Instructions

Grievances (both directions) per met civ, plus recent gossip about them.

Grievances predict AI hostility; check when planning war, peace, or World Congress votes.
